Main Features Compared
HoudiniEsq
- Case Management: Comprehensive case management tools that streamline workflow.
- Document Management: Effortless document storage and retrieval, enhancing accessibility.
- Billing and Invoicing: Integrated billing features simplify payment processes for clients.
ThoughtRiver
- AI Contract Review: Leverages artificial intelligence to analyze and review contracts quickly.
- Risk Assessment: Provides assessment tools to identify potential risks in legal documents.
- Collaboration Features: Advanced collaboration tools facilitate communication among team members.

| Feature | HoudiniEsq | ThoughtRiver |
|---|---|---|
| Case Management | Yes | No |
| Document Management | Yes | No |
| Billing and Invoicing | Yes | No |
| AI Contract Review | No | Yes |
| Risk Assessment | No | Yes |
| Collaboration Tools | Limited | Advanced |
| Price | $0 | $0 |
The Verdict: Which One Should You Choose?
Choosing between HoudiniEsq and ThoughtRiver ultimately depends on your law firm’s specific needs. If your focus is on case and document management with straightforward billing functionalities, HoudiniEsq proves to be an invaluable resource. Conversely, if your firm places a premium on AI-driven contract analysis and collaborative features, ThoughtRiver is the clear winner.
